Output c23c99eddfac21e11dd4e66981f5689da69720e9cf999d266fa430b8450a2185:46

value
26171653
script pubkey
OP_0 OP_PUSHBYTES_20 dbf5caf8e444a3eebeda6d57729d19805b9151a7
address
bc1qm06u478ygj37a0k6d4th98gespdez5d873pt6s
transaction
c23c99eddfac21e11dd4e66981f5689da69720e9cf999d266fa430b8450a2185
spent
true